When you create a Flash animation in Director, let's say a bouncy ball, the generated file is very small because it is not created frame by frame but instead (the same way as Revolution does) is has layers of graphics and small code about position (and other info) for each graphic at any point in the timeline. I hope you can understand me.

I want to know if any of you have worked with this to export small flash animations from Revolution. Any advice is welcome.

Erik wrote this yesterday and I want to know if it is possible to export a Rev animation as a video (any format) via scripts, not with external capturing software.

As always, 'Trevor's wonderful EnhancedQT External'. :-)

<http://www.bluemangolearning.com/developer/revolution/enhancedqt.php>

You would have to export each frame as an image file, then load them up using the external and turn them into a movie file.
